在信息爆炸的时代,如何有效地展示历史事件、项目进度或个人经历,时间轴是一个非常好的选择。而使用jQuery时间轴插件,你可以轻松实现这一功能,让时间轴动态且美观地呈现在网页上。本文将详细介绍如何使用jQuery时间轴插件,让你一键下载并打造出令人印象深刻的时间轴展示效果。
一、jQuery时间轴插件简介
jQuery时间轴插件是一款基于jQuery库的轻量级插件,它可以帮助你快速制作出响应式的时间轴。该插件具有以下特点:
- 响应式设计:适应不同屏幕尺寸,确保时间轴在各种设备上都能正常显示。
- 易于定制:支持多种样式和颜色,可以轻松满足个性化需求。
- 动态效果:支持动画效果,使时间轴更加生动有趣。
- 兼容性强:兼容主流浏览器,如Chrome、Firefox、Safari、Edge等。
二、下载与安装jQuery时间轴插件
- 下载插件:首先,你需要从官方网站或其他可靠来源下载jQuery时间轴插件。以下是一些建议的下载地址:
- 引入jQuery库:在HTML文件中引入jQuery库,以便使用jQuery时间轴插件。以下是引入jQuery库的代码示例:
<script src="https://cdn.bootcdn.net/ajax/libs/jquery/3.6.0/jquery.min.js"></script>
- 引入时间轴插件:将下载的时间轴插件文件引入HTML文件中。以下是引入时间轴插件的代码示例:
<script src="path/to/jquery.timeaxis.min.js"></script>
三、使用jQuery时间轴插件
- HTML结构:首先,你需要创建一个HTML结构来承载时间轴。以下是一个简单的HTML结构示例:
<div id="time-axis" class="time-axis"></div>
- CSS样式:接下来,你可以根据需要为时间轴添加CSS样式。以下是时间轴的基本样式:
.time-axis {
width: 100%;
margin: 0 auto;
position: relative;
}
.time-axis .event {
position: relative;
padding: 10px;
border-left: 2px solid #333;
margin-bottom: 20px;
}
.time-axis .event:before {
content: "";
position: absolute;
left: -10px;
top: 50%;
margin-top: -5px;
width: 10px;
height: 10px;
background-color: #333;
border-radius: 50%;
}
- JavaScript代码:最后,你需要编写JavaScript代码来初始化时间轴插件。以下是初始化时间轴插件的代码示例:
$(document).ready(function() {
$('#time-axis').timeaxis({
// 配置项
});
});
- 添加事件数据:将事件数据添加到时间轴中。以下是一个事件数据的示例:
var events = [
{
date: '2021-01-01',
title: '事件1',
content: '这里是事件1的详细描述。'
},
{
date: '2021-02-01',
title: '事件2',
content: '这里是事件2的详细描述。'
},
// ... 更多事件
];
$('#time-axis').timeaxis('addEvents', events);
四、总结
通过以上步骤,你就可以轻松地使用jQuery时间轴插件制作出动态且美观的时间轴。这款插件不仅可以帮助你展示历史事件、项目进度或个人经历,还能让你的网页更具吸引力。希望本文能帮助你掌握时间轴制作技巧,让你的作品更加出色!
